    Abstract: Provided is a loop antenna array that can easily create a magnetic field distribution which enables the boundary of a communication area to be clearly set. 2n loop antennae are provided adjacently to one another, where n is a natural number. The directions of currents in adjacent ones of the loop antennae are opposite to each other. For example, in a loop antenna array, two loop antennae are disposed adjacently to each other on an insulator substrate. First feed points energize one loop antenna and second feed points energize the other loop antenna.

    Abstract: Provided is a loop antenna which can contribute to an increase of an area of a radio system using a magnetic field. The loop antenna includes a main loop 1 which is an open loop connected to a signal source 5 or a reception circuit; and an amplification loop 2 which is a closed loop having the same shape as the main loop 1. The main loop 1 and the amplification loop 2 are arranged on a same surface of a flat substrate formed of an insulator. A first capacitance is connected to the main loop 1, and a second capacitance is connected to the amplification loop.

    Abstract: A main loop is an open loop that is wound on a bar-shaped rod formed of a magnetic body or an insulation body and that has terminals T and T that couple a signal source or a receiving circuit to the main loop. The number of turns is 1 or more. An amplifying loop is wound on a part of the rod that is different from the part on which the main loop is wound. The main loop and the amplifying loop are thus spaced from each other. The amplifying loop is a closed loop including no terminals. The number of turns is 1 or more. The number of turns may be the same as or different from the number of turns of the main loop.
